This is an account of a teacher and her class as they undertake a life changing odyssey toward understanding and racial tolerance. Shocked by the teenage violence she witnessed during the Rodney King riots in Los Angeles, Erin Gruwell became a teacher at a high school rampant with hostility and racial intolerance.
